They are currently looking for a Partnership Manager to join them where you will provide effective links with schools in the region, promoting recruitment to the Group. This is a part time position, working 22.5 hours per week and is a fixed term contract until the end of June 2017.

As a Partnership Manager, you will develop and coordinate internal taster events, working with students to communicate opportunities within the college. Assisting in the co-ordination and implementation of the college’s 14-19 strategy, you will co-ordinate activities with Schools Liaison tutors in the college, offering guidance and support for 14-16 delivery.

Managing all curriculum partnership activity and ensuring that targets within recruitment, contribution, attendance, success rates and progression are achieved, you will also be responsible for handling the provision of careers and progression talks within secondary schools.

Our client is looking for someone who is qualified to degree level or equivalent professional qualification, coupled with a strong background in teaching and curriculum development. With an understanding of curriculum in Schools and FE, and with a detailed knowledge of changes to 14-19 curriculum and implications for the College, you will have experience in FE Admissions procedures and a knowledge of marketing programmes and activities.

Excellent ICT and Presentation skills are key, as is having experience of working with schools, funding agencies and Councils. In addition, you will have a high level of organisational skills, a flexible approach, and the ability to work well under pressure.
